Who Won the Los Angeles Sparks vs Connecticut Sun Game

The Los Angeles Sparks pulled off a hard fought 92 to 88 win over the Connecticut Sun. Playing on their home floor gave LA a real edge, and the crowd energy helped the Sparks close out a game that stayed close through three quarters. This result snapped a long losing streak the Sparks had against the Sun, which made the win feel even bigger for the home crowd.

What Was the Final Score

The final score read Sparks 92, Sun 88. The scoring by quarter tells the real story of how this game unfolded.

  • First quarter: Sun 30, Sparks 27
  • Second quarter: Sun 19, Sparks 20
  • Third quarter: Sun 18, Sparks 22
  • Fourth quarter: Sun 21, Sparks 23

Connecticut jumped out fast, but Los Angeles chipped away every quarter and took control down the stretch. That is the kind of finish that makes any Sparks vs Sun live score worth following until the final buzzer.

Who Scored the Most Points in the Game

Bria Hartley led all scorers with 25 points for Connecticut, shooting an efficient 7 of 17 from the field and 7 of 8 from the free throw line. For Los Angeles, Kelsey Plum led the way with 23 points, scoring 18 of those in the second half alone. Azura Stevens was right behind her with 21 points and 11 rebounds, giving the Sparks two players in scoring range of 20 or more.

Which Player Had the Most Rebounds

Azura Stevens grabbed the rebounding crown with 11 boards, a mix of four defensive and seven offensive rebounds. That second chance production gave the Sparks extra possessions all night. On the Connecticut side, Aneesah Morrow led her team with 7 rebounds, keeping the Sun competitive on the glass even though they came up short overall.

Who Recorded the Most Assists

Bria Hartley and Julie Allemand tied for the game high with 6 assists each. Hartley set up her Connecticut teammates with sharp passing out of pick and roll sets, while Allemand ran the Sparks offense with poise, especially in crunch time when Los Angeles needed clean looks.

What Is the Head to Head Record Between the Sparks and Sun

This season, the Sparks swept the season series against the Sun 3 to 0. That marks a shift after Connecticut had held the upper hand in recent matchups. If you follow WNBA Los Angeles coverage closely, you know this rivalry has gone back and forth over the years, so a clean sweep stands out as a notable moment for Sparks fans.

How Did the Result Impact the WNBA Standings

The win pushed the Sparks to a 10 and 11 record, keeping them in playoff contention in the Western Conference. Connecticut fell to 5 and 18, sitting near the bottom of the Eastern Conference.
